How to install a Kill Switch on a car battery?

Once you have the positive cable removed you need to remove the terminal from the end of the cable. With the terminal removed, you can now install the kill switch. Wire the switch in between the cable and the battery terminal. Make sure that when you install the switch that you install it in the on position.

How do you splice a Kill Switch?

To splice the wire, simply use wire cutters to cut it across the middle. From there, use wire strippers to carefully strip both ends. This will prepare the wires for the installation and connection of your kill switch.

How much does it cost to install a kill switch in a car?

Many locksmiths, car-stereo installers and auto-alarm specialists will put in a basic kill switch for less than $100; the price ranges from $80 to $150 in the New York City area. By comparison, alarms can be had for as little as $70 at auto-parts stores.

How to prevent theft of car fuse?

A common way to prevent theft is to take out a fuse, such as the ignition fuse or the fuel pump fuse, which in turn, prevents your car from being started. However, you need not manually pull out the fuse each time to get out of the car. A fuse box kill switch helps you in this regard. It allows you to install a fuse bypass switch in an area that is easy for you to reach and switch it on or off. However, one of the drawbacks of this setup is that the wire that goes into the fuse box might stick out a bit, thus preventing you from closing your fuse box lid completely.

How to test a car wire?

Start by connecting the black probe from the multimeter to a bare metal surface (this will ground it). Then, turn the tool on and set it to 20 DCV. You can then use the red probe to test each wire individually , making sure the car is on as you’re testing. The live wire should test around 12 volts.

How do I disconnect a fuel pump relay?

To disconnect the fuel pump relay assembly, simply press in the tab and disconnect the wiring harness. Then, wiggle it back and forth to remove it. Do not pull on any of the wires, as this can cause damage.

What happens when the kill switch is engaged?

When the kill switch is engaged, the circuit that tells the fuel pump relay to turn on gets cut; as a result, the relay cannot send the signal to the fuel pump to turn on — which prevents your car from being stolen.
